How they compare

Norway currently reports 122.79 kg/ha against 28.42 kg/ha in Caribbean, a difference of 94.37 kg/ha.

That makes Norway's figure about 4.3 times Caribbean's.

Across all 64 years both countries report, Norway has been ahead every year.

Caribbean ranks 22nd and Norway ranks 21st of 29 groups.

Norway has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Caribbean Norway Difference Ahead
1960s 28.43 kg/ha 74.14 kg/ha 45.71 kg/ha Norway
1970s 37.58 kg/ha 116.61 kg/ha 79.03 kg/ha Norway
1980s 54 kg/ha 128.22 kg/ha 74.22 kg/ha Norway
1990s 31.16 kg/ha 120.44 kg/ha 89.28 kg/ha Norway
2000s 16.19 kg/ha 117.9 kg/ha 101.71 kg/ha Norway
2010s 21.18 kg/ha 121.23 kg/ha 100.05 kg/ha Norway
2020s 27.15 kg/ha 130.2 kg/ha 103.05 kg/ha Norway

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Fertilizers by Nutrient dataset contains information on the totals in nutrients for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ers. The data are provided for the three primary plant nutrients: nitrogen (N), phosphorus (expressed as P2O5) and potassium (expressed as K2O).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
